You guys haven't seen Illinois and Purdue yet, but I guess what you just make of sort of the contenders or that top tier that have won at the top of this league and what you see is your guys is key to surviving this thing?

0:39.3

Staying healthy, staying together, just playing well to right times, timely, timely shooting.

0:49.1

Those teams are really, really good.

0:51.2

And I heard a coach say it the other day that it's not who you play, it's when you play them. And the ebbs and flows of the season where you catch them in their schedule and your schedule, you know, those things all matter. But we've got a Penn State team that gave us everything and then some on this Thursday. We're focused on that game, and I'm not even sure who we play.
